The Heller Gallery is a contemporary art gallery with displays of glass and sculpture. Artists include Hank Adams, Susan Taylor Giasgow, Martin Rosoi, and Ivana Sramkova.

The Sean Kelly Gallery has works by established contemporary American and international artists such as James Casebere, Christine Borland, Callum Innes, and Marina, Abramovic.

Sikkema Jenkins, a contemporary art gallery located in Chelsea, has works from artists such as Burt Barr, Rachel Berwick, Mitch Epstein, Arturo Herrera, and David Humphrey.
